Transaction 6d620ca44f7ef8b3251e70f156d1696255ffb80f67d2552e21ab043e89bf69bb
1 Input
1 Output
-
6d620ca44f7ef8b3251e70f156d1696255ffb80f67d2552e21ab043e89bf69bb:0
- value
- 2458829
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f377379799555c57f81be84d220eb3180b99c9 OP_EQUAL
- address
- 3BMEXyiuhsYYv9VvK6bLKTXWfXH6sbuwyL